Cocoa Futures Market News and Commentary

Cocoa Prices Surge on El Niño Fears

July ICE NY cocoa (CCN26) on Thursday closed up +292 (+7.06%), and July ICE London cocoa #7 (CAN26) closed up +189 (+6.09%).

Cocoa prices on Thursday extended this week's sharp rally, with NY cocoa posting a 3-month high and London cocoa posting a 3.5-month high.  Cocoa prices surged on Thursday amid concerns that the formation of an El Niño weather pattern could lead to warmer, drier conditions in West Africa, potentially damaging cocoa production in the region.  The US National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) estimates  a 61% probability that El Niño conditions will emerge between May and July and persist through the end of the year, with a one-in-four chance of a "Super El Niño."

Cocoa prices also have support from early surveys of the 2026/27 West African cocoa crop that show below-average cherelle formation on cocoa trees, signaling a weak outlook for the main cocoa harvest, which begins in October.
